This year, the festival took place at the Terry O'Toole Theatre in Lincoln on Saturday 6 December. The evening drew in an audience of 85, who enjoyed performances from inclusive dance groups, alongside unique performances by Propel Dance, the UK’s first and only award-winning professional wheelchair dance company.
Young dancers from the Inspire Youth Arts Dance Development Programme lit up the stage with the premiere of their groundbreaking new dance piece, Before the Last Tree Falls. For the first time, three male dancers from Inspire Youth Arts’ inclusive dance groups came together to create something truly special. Over the course of just six intense, collaborative days, they worked alongside the new Artistic Director and Choreographer, Siobhan Hayes, to bring this performance to life. A fusion of creativity, passion, and raw energy, this performance marks an exciting new chapter in the Dance Development Programme.
